实验室设备管理系统论文


时间: 2021-08-21 10:57:38 人气: 100 评论: 0

随着高校管理变革的逐步推进,实验室建设进一步规范化、复杂化,高校实验室管理工作也变得更加繁重和复杂。为了便于管理工作的展开,提高工作效率,利用计算机来进行辅助管理,以简化实验室的管理工作,本系统正是针对上述问题进行开发设计。系统采用B/S模式,纯面向对象思想(OOP),利用SQL Server 2008作为数据库管理工具,模块复用率高、系统维护代价小,方便、灵活、高效。管理系统包括以下功能模块:人员信息管理,实验室信息管理,实验室设备管理等功能模块。全面支持广域网络办公模式,可大大减少实验教学管理的工作量。

我校计算机学院实验室是一个人、物、帐、课等对象的一个综合体,如何对这些对象的进行有效管理一直是一个难题,在信息化社会的现在,建立实验室网站是大势所趋,本设计立足以实用,设计并开发一个计算机学院实验室网站系统,这将为实验室的管理和办公提供极大促进。

关键词:ASP.NET;B/S;设备管理;SQL Server 2008

3.2功能需求

(1) 人员管理:该模块负责实验室人员的各种调整,和各种业绩考核。人员调整主要有添加,删除,修改,查询;业绩考核主要有平时考勤,加班,绩效等;

该模块对人员进行管理,主要有以下子模块:

添加模块:在浏览器中添加新的实验室人员信息入数据库;

删除模块:从浏览器中删除实验室人员,并且从数据库中删除;

查询模块:实现对实验室人员的信息查询;

修改模块:实现对人员的信息修改;

考勤模块:记录实验室人员平时的出勤情况;

加班模块:主演实现记录人员的不同时间(周末,假日等)的加班情况;

    绩效模块:主要记录人员的工作业绩情况,如获得不同等级奖励等。

(2) 实验室信息管理:该模块主要负责实验室教室信息的添加,修改,删除和查询功能;

该模块对人员进行管理,主要有以下子模块:

添加模块:在浏览器中添加新的实验室教室信息入数据库;

删除模块:从浏览器中删除实验室教室,并且从数据库中删除;

查询模块:实现对实验室的信息查询;

修改模块:实现对实验室的信息修改;

(3) 实验室设备管理:该模块主要负责实验室设备的管理,主要包括:设备分类建账,录入,修改,查询,修改,借还,维修,报废等功能。

分类建账:将所有设备进行分类,按照各种条目进行分类建账;

录入模块:在浏览器中录入新的台帐信息。在复杂和大量的信息录入操作中,

如何面向操作人员,实现人性化便捷的录入是该模块主要的设计理念;

查询模块:实现对台帐的任何条目进行关键词查询;

修改模块:实现对设备的信息修改;

删除模块:从浏览器中删除实验室设备,并且从数据库中删除;

借还模块:对设备的借出归还进行统计建账;

维修模块:对损坏设备修复情况的进行统计和建账;

报废模块:对已过期设备和损坏过度无法修复的设备的统计建账;


  目  录

第一章 绪论 1

1.1本课题的研究背景 1

1.2国内外研究现状 1

1.3本课题的研究意义 1

1.4开发环境 2

第二章  系统相关技术 3

2.1开发工具 3

2.1.1 Microsoft Visual Studio 2008 3

2.1.2 SQL Server 2008 3

2.1.3 ASP.NET介绍 4

2.2使用技术 5

2.2.1 Web技术及其特点 5

2.2.2 Ajax技术 6

2.3采用语言 6

第三章 需求分析 8

3.1可行性分析 8

3.1.1 技术可行性 8

3.1.2 经济可行性 8

3.1.3 操作可行性 8

3.1.4法律可行性 8

3.2功能需求 9

3.3研究方案 9

3.4系统业务流程图 10

3.5数据库的连接 11

3.6数据设计 12

第四章 总体设计 13

4.1数据库表结构设计 13

4.1.1  E-R图 13

4.1.2 数据库表的详细 15

第五章 详细设计与实现 19

5.1 帐号信息管理 19

5.2 部门信息管理 20

5.3 账号管理 22

5.4 加班信息管理 24

5.5 考勤信息管理 27

5.6 考核信息管理 28

5.7 员工信息管理 29

5.8实验室信息管理 30

5.9 设备管理 31

5.10 设备借还管理 32

5.11 设备维修管理 32

5.12设备报废管理 32

第六章 总结 34

6.1 总结 34

6.2 体会 34

致  谢 36

参考文献 37


评论
188083800